Buying Guide: best riding lawn mower tires for hills
Tread Pattern and Traction
Choose tires with aggressive or multi-trace tread patterns to maximize grip on slopes. Deep treads help prevent slipping and improve control on wet or uneven ground.
Load Capacity and Durability
Ensure the tires support your mower’s weight plus any additional load. Durable materials and reinforced construction extend tire life on rough terrain.
Size and Compatibility
Match tire size exactly to your mower’s specifications, including diameter, width, rim size, and bushing diameter. Compatibility avoids installation issues and ensures safe operation.
Pneumatic vs. Tubeless Tires
Pneumatic tires offer better shock absorption and traction but require maintenance to avoid flats. Tubeless tires reduce flat risks and are easier to install but may have less cushioning.
Installation and Maintenance
Look for pre-assembled tire and wheel kits to simplify installation. Regularly check air pressure and tread wear to maintain performance on hills.
FAQs: best riding lawn mower tires for hills
What tire size is best for hilly riding mowers?
Sizes like 15×6.00-6 and 20×8.00-8 are common for hilly terrain, offering good balance of traction and stability.
Are tubeless tires better for hills?
Tubeless tires reduce flat risks but pneumatic tires often provide better shock absorption and grip on slopes.
How do I know if a tire fits my mower?
Check your mower’s manual or existing tire sidewall for size, rim diameter, and bushing measurements before purchasing.
Can I use front tires on the rear wheels for hills?
It’s best to use tires designed for their specific wheel positions to ensure proper traction and safety.
How often should I replace mower tires used on hills?
Replace tires when tread wears thin or if you notice slipping, typically every few seasons depending on use and terrain.
Do wider tires perform better on hills?
Wider tires can offer more surface contact and stability but may affect maneuverability; balance width with your mower’s design.
Is it necessary to have adjustable bushings for hill tires?
Adjustable bushings help fit tires to various hub sizes, making installation easier and more secure on different mower models.
